Импорт контактов

Редактировал(а) Татьяна Брыкова 2026/03/10 13:08

Импорт контактов осуществляется аналогично импорту любой другой сущности по шагам, описанным здесь.

Необходимо обратить внимание на особенности заполнения шаблона импорта, какие поля обязательные и какой тип данных должен применяться к столбцам файла шаблона

 Скачать шаблон:Импорт → Создать → Скачать шаблон → выбрать «Контакт».
2.Открыть в Excel.Первая строка — заголовки (56 столбцов). Не изменять и не удалять!
3.Настроить форматы:Выделить все столбцы → ПКМ → Формат ячеек → Текстовый. Столбцы с датами (№ 11, 24, 47, 48, 53) → Дата (ДД.ММ.ГГГГ).
4.Заполнить данныеСо второй строки. Справочники — строго как в таблице выше. Макс. 40 000 строк, файл до 8 Мб.
5.Сохранить как .xlsx(не .xls). Загрузить: Импорт → Загрузить файл → Импортировать.
6.Проверить результат:Статус импорта, вкладки «Импортированные строки» и «Ошибки импорта», «Детали импорта»

Как работать с шаблоном

Перед заполнением проверить, что:

  •  все столбцы → формат «Текстовый»,
  • столбцы с датами → формат «Дата» (ДД.ММ.ГГГГ).
  • значения справочников введены точно как указано - «Да»/«Нет»

Рекомендуем сначала загрузить 1–2 тестовые строки. При успешном импорте заполнять весь файл.

Для обновления существующего контакта — заполняется  поле «ID записи (для обновления)» (GUID из системы).

Типы полей: Строка — текст  |  Справ. — строго из списка  |  Дата — ДД.ММ.ГГГГ  |  Ссылка — GUID записи  |  URL — полный адрес
 

ПолеСистемное имяТипФорматОбязательноеДопустимые значения
1Внешний IDExternalIdСтрокаТекстНет
2ПартнерPartnerIdСсылкаТекстДаGUID
3StateCodeStateCodeСтрокаТекстДа
4StatusCodeStatusCodeСтрокаТекстДа
5Персональные заметкиDescriptionСтрокаТекстНет
6Субъект правоотношенийSubjectOfLegalRelationsСправ.ТекстДаФиз. лицо | Юр. лицо | Гражд. союз
7Предпочтительный способ связиPreferredCommunicationChannelСправ.ТекстДаЛюбой | Телефон | Почта | SMS | WhatsApp | В офисе | Telegram
8ИмяFirstNameСтрокаТекстДа
9ОтчествоMiddleNameСтрокаТекстНет
10ФамилияLastNameСтрокаТекстДа
11День рожденияBirthdayДатаДатаНетДД.ММ.ГГГГ
12ПолGenderСправ.ТекстНетМужчина | Женщина
13Имеет детейChildrenStatusСправ.ТекстНетДа | Нет | Неизвестно
14Семейное положениеMaritalStatusСправ.ТекстНетХолост/Не замужем | Женат/Замужем | В разводе | Вдовец/Вдова
15Электронная почтаEMailAddress1СтрокаТекстДаuser@domain.com
16Электронная почта 2EMailAddress2СтрокаТекстНет
17Мобильный телефонMobilePhoneСтрокаТекстДа+79991234567
18Есть в мобильном приложенииMobileAppСправ.ТекстНетДа | Нет
19Дополнительный телефонTelephone1СтрокаТекстНет+79991234567
20Коммуникации по E-mailAllowEMailSendingСправ.ТекстНетДа | Нет
21Коммуникации по телефонуAllowMobilePhoneCallingСправ.ТекстНетДа | Нет
22ЛогинLoginСтрокаТекстНет
23Статус контактаParticipantStatusСправ.ТекстДаАктивный | В черном листе | Заблокирован | Отложен
24Дата регистрацииRegistrationOnДатаДатаНетДД.ММ.ГГГГ
25Коммуникации по SMSAllowSmsSendingСправ.ТекстНетДа | Нет
26Источник анкетыQuestionnaireSourceСправ.ТекстДа23 значения (см. ниже)
27ТранслитерацияUseTransliterationForSmsСправ.ТекстНетДа | Нет
28Валидность анкетыValidityStatusСправ.ТекстНетПусто | Проверен | Не прошел проверку | На проверке
29Мобильный телефон проверенHasVerifiedMobileСправ.ТекстНетДа | Нет
30E-mail проверенHasVerifiedEMailСправ.ТекстНетДа | Нет
31Временная зонаTimezoneСтрокаТекстНетUTC+3
32Разрешить уведомленияAllowNotificationСправ.ТекстНетДа | Нет
33Согласен на обработку персональных данныхHasAgreeToTermsСправ.ТекстДаДа | Нет
34Тип контактаTypeСправ.ТекстДаУчастник ПЛ | Подписчик | Сотрудник | Не участник ПЛ | Технический
35Редактируемый уровеньAllowLevelEditableСправ.ТекстНетДа | Нет
36Магазин частых покупокFrequentShopIdСсылкаТекстНетGUID
37Магазин регистрацииRegistrationShopIdСсылкаТекстНетGUID
38Любимый магазинPreferableShopIdСсылкаТекстНетGUID
39Cсылка на картинкуImageUrlURLТекстНетhttps://...
40РегионAddressRegionСтрокаТекстНет
41ГородAddressCityСтрокаТекстНет
42УлицаAddressStreetСтрокаТекстНет
43ДомAddressHouseСтрокаТекстНет
44ЭтажAddressFloorСтрокаТекстНет
45КвартираAddressFlatСтрокаТекстНет
46Наличие карты в WalletHasWalletСправ.ТекстНетДа | Нет
47Дата привязки карты в WalletWalletBindOnДатаДатаНетДД.ММ.ГГГГ
48Дата отвязки карты в WalletWalletUnbindOnДатаДатаНетДД.ММ.ГГГГ
49Согласие на электронный чекAllowReceiveChequeByEmailСправ.ТекстНетДа | Нет
50Карта по умолчаниюDefaultBonusCardIdСсылкаТекстНетGUID
51УровеньLevelIdСсылкаТекстНетGUID
52Роль в личном кабинетеWebAreaRoleIdСсылкаТекстНетGUID
53Дата окончания действия уровняLevelFinishDateДатаДатаНетДД.ММ.ГГГГ
54Полнота анкетыIsActivatedСправ.ТекстНетДа | Нет
55Кристалл IDCrystalIdСтрокаТекстНет
56ID записи (для обновления)IdGUIDТекстТолько при обновленииGUID существующей записи

Частые ошибки при импорте

ПроблемаРешение
Телефон +79991234567 → 79991234567 или 7.999E+10Формат столбца «Текстовый» ДО ввода данных. Если уже ввели — удалите, смените формат, введите заново.
GUID обрезается / научная нотация (1.23E+15)Формат «Текстовый». Пример GUID: a1b2c3d4-e5f6-7890-abcd-ef1234567890
Дата 01.02.2024 → 02.01.2024 (день/месяц перепутаны)Формат «Дата» → ДД.ММ.ГГГГ. Не использовать ММ/ДД/ГГГГ.
«Да» / «Нет» → TRUE / FALSEФормат «Текстовый». Вводить  «Да» или «Нет» как текст.
Лишние пробелы: « Да» ≠ «Да»Значения справочников — точное совпадение. Используйте СЖПРОБЕЛЫ() / TRIM().
Ведущие нули пропадают: этаж «01» → «1»Формат «Текстовый» сохраняет ведущие нули.
Не заполнены обязательные поляПроверьте столбец «Обязательное» = Да в таблице выше. Без них строка не импортируется.
Значение справочника не из спискаВводить строго как указано. «Мужской» ≠ «Мужчина», «да» ≠ «Да».